Man Arrested for Assaulting Wife with Hot Oil and Knife in Ogun State

The Ogun State Police Command, Egba Division, has taken Kazeem Sholola into custody for allegedly assaulting his wife, Mutiat Sholola, by pouring hot oil on her and stabbing her in the head during a domestic dispute.

The incident reportedly occurred in the Ring Road community of Owode Egba, within the Obafemi/Owode Local Government Area, following a disagreement between the couple.

In a statement released on Saturday, the Police Public Relations Officer, CSP Omolola Odutola, confirmed the arrest and provided details of the case.

According to the statement, the police were notified of the incident by a community member at about 12:20 p.m. on Saturday, which led to the immediate arrest of the suspect.

Mutiat, who sustained serious burns and head injuries, is currently receiving medical treatment at Ore Ofé Hospital in Owode Egba.

The statement reads in part: “The Divisional Police Officer of Owode Egba Division promptly responded to a case of domestic violence, leading to the arrest of a man accused of inflicting severe injuries on his wife.

“On January 18, 2025, at approximately 12:20 p.m., members of the Ring Road community reported an incident involving Kazeem Sholola and his wife, Mutiat.

“It was alleged that, during a heated disagreement, Kazeem poured hot oil on his wife and stabbed her in the head in a fit of rage

 

 

 

 

“The victim was rushed to Ore Ofe Hospital for urgent medical attention, while officers examined the scene of the incident. The suspect is currently in police custody as investigations continue.”
